Ten adult illegal Syrian immigrants were spotted this morning boarding a boat off Cape Greco in the free province of Famagusta.
According to the Police, around 10.30 this morning, a boat was spotted by a Coast Guard patrol boat sailing off Cape Greco.
The Port and Maritime Police rushed to the scene and accompanied the boat with the illegal immigrants to the Golden Coast fishing shelter in Protaras.
Aboard the boat, which arrived at the fishing shelter shortly after 2.30 pm today, were 10 Syrian men aged 21 to 42 years who, according to the Police, had departed from the Syrian city of Tartus, yesterday, Thursday, April 15th.
After recording the details of the illegal immigrants, the latter are expected to be transferred to the “Pournara” Temporary Accommodation Center in Kokkinotrimithia accompanied by the Police.
